Key Business Tasks to Automate First in Mississippi

Implementing automation and AI in your Mississippi business can significantly improve efficiency and reduce operational costs. Prioritize automating tasks that are repetitive, time-consuming, and prone to human error.

Recommended Tasks for Initial Automation

  • Bookkeeping and Accounting: Automate invoice processing, expense tracking, and financial reporting to ensure accurate recordkeeping and simplify tax preparation.
  • Payroll Management: Use automation tools for calculating wages, tax withholdings, and generating pay stubs to maintain compliance with Mississippi payroll tax requirements.
  • Employee Onboarding and HR Compliance: Streamline new hire paperwork, employee classification, and benefits enrollment to stay compliant with state labor laws.
  • Inventory Management: Automate stock tracking and reorder alerts to optimize supply levels and reduce carrying costs.
  • Customer Relationship Management (CRM): Use AI-powered systems to automate lead tracking, follow-ups, and customer support, improving sales and service efficiency.
  • Regulatory Reporting: Automate data collection and submission processes for state-required business registrations and compliance filings.

Operational Benefits

Starting with these automation areas helps Mississippi businesses reduce manual errors, ensure timely compliance with state regulations, and free up staff to focus on strategic growth activities.
